Know Your Audience and Their Legal Questions

Before you create content, you have to understand who you’re talking to. What are your potential clients worried about? What questions are they searching online?

Attorney content marketing thrives when it answers specific concerns. A personal injury firm, for example, should write about things like what to do after an accident or how long a client has to file a claim. Think about your practice areas and what your ideal clients need to know. That’s where your content focus should begin.

What Makes Content Valuable to Your Audience?

There’s a big difference between generic blog posts and content that truly helps your readers. Valuable content does one or more of the following:

  • Educates the reader about a legal issue or process
  • Explains legal rights in simple terms
  • Answers common questions clients often ask
  • Tells a compelling story that connects with the reader

When you provide this type of value through your attorney content marketing, you’re more likely to earn a reader’s trust—and their business.

Don’t Forget Local Focus

Most law firms serve specific geographic areas, so it makes sense to tailor your content to those locations. Writing about state-specific laws, local courts, or recent regional legal news can improve your visibility in local searches.

The Long-Term Value of Legal Content

One of the biggest benefits of attorney content marketing is its long-term payoff. Unlike paid ads that stop the moment your budget runs out, your content keeps working for you. A well-written blog post can continue bringing in traffic for months or even years.

Over time, this builds a strong foundation for your firm’s online presence. It helps you grow authority, reach, and influence, all without having to fight for attention in the moment.
